“Mastering Bookkeeping Basics: A Practical Guide for Small Businesses” is a comprehensive resource aimed at demystifying bookkeeping for non-accountants. The primary objective of any business is to generate profit, and bookkeeping is the key to achieving this goal. It involves meticulously recording all financial transactions and using these records to produce essential financial statements that provide crucial insights into a company’s financial health and profitability.

This book breaks down the intricacies of bookkeeping into 14 easy-to-follow chapters, with illustrations to enhance comprehension. Subsequently, it introduces fundamental bookkeeping concepts and the mechanics of double-entry accounting, making debits and credits understandable.

Readers will gain the ability to identify, comprehend, and accurately record financial transactions and create a chart of accounts to organize their business’s financial data. The book progresses through general journal and ledger entries, trial balances, and adjusting entries. It culminates in preparing income statements and balance sheets for evaluating a company’s financial performance and overall financial position. The closing chapter provides a clear guide to preparing financial records for the subsequent accounting period.
